Just set up my new Xbox Series X on a 2020 Q80T 55-inch TV, and whenever I switch between games, Game Mode (which is on Auto) turns off and on repeatedly. It stays on, which is good, but appears super buggy until it gets there. 

 

This happens while switching between games, menus, etc. It should just stay on until I'm no longer on the Xbox. When Game Mode is on manual on/off, it works fine, but it'd be great if Auto was a better experience. Anyone else with this issue or know how to solve it?

You can sort of fix it by putting the hdmi 4 channel on game mode on. And not auto settings. Just like if you use a xbox . I have a series x had a lot of issues with manually fixing things like : sound delay, flickering screen when starting up game switching on off on off game modus . So i started with setting the hdmi 4 instead of game modus auto to on. That helped alot, and if you use a soundbar in earc ,(i have a Q90T and Q950T) the sound delays are terrible with dolby atmos because samsung wont fix the auto settings on sound options. Only setting it to passtrough fixes it a little bit. Still lag but pffff... i hope this helps you a little bit and i hope that samsung sort there things out.

There has been a lot of issues with game mode on Samsungs 2020 TVs. My Series X and Q95T get stuck in a constant game mode on/off loop when launching games in auto and I have to manually turn off game mode to get the game to display and then turn game mode back on. Extremely annoying. They have updated the firmware multiple times and hopefully they keep doing so to get it right with the next gen consoles.
